Output e8ce580bcb63cc48ec9e49b7dbaa53fa3def28cb115f824c918ae425f8b85cd1:0

value
4314358848
script pubkey
OP_0 OP_PUSHBYTES_20 15009f3af9b474d20cdf08d1b8032d6e80813917
address
tb1qz5qf7whek36dyrxlprgmsqedd6qgzwghqgakfz
transaction
e8ce580bcb63cc48ec9e49b7dbaa53fa3def28cb115f824c918ae425f8b85cd1